Investigation of the Structural, Mechanical and Operational Properties of an Alloy AlSi18Cu3CrMn
Original language description
A non-standardized hypereutectic aluminum-silicon alloy, AlSi18Cu3CrMn, was developed. To refine the structure of the studied composition, a phosphorus modifier was used in an amount of 0.04 wt %, and a complex modifying treatment was applied by combining the chemical elements of phosphorus, titanium, boron and beryllium (P, 0.04 wt %; Ti, 0.2 wt %; B, 0.04 wt %; Be, 0.007 wt %). To improve the mechanical and operational properties of the alloy, it was heat-treated (T6) at a temperature of 510-515 degrees C before quenching, with artificial aging applied at a temperature of 210 degrees C for 16 h. Phosphorus-modified alloy AlSi18Cu3CrMn was quenched in water at 20 degrees C, and the combined modified alloy was quenched in water at temperatures of 20 degrees C and 50 degrees C. By conducting a microstructural analysis, the free Si crystals and silicon crystals in the composition of the eutectic in the alloy structure were characterized, and by conducting XRD, the presence and type of secondary phases were established. The hardness of the alloy was measured, as well as the microhardness of the alpha-solid solution. Static uniaxial tensile testing was carried out at normal and elevated temperatures (working temperatures of 200 degrees C, 250 degrees C and 300 degrees C). By using a gravimetric method, the corrosion rate of the alloy in 1 M NaCl and 1 M H2SO4 was calculated. The mass wear, wear intensity and wear resistance of the studied AlSi18Cu3CrMn alloy were determined during reversible reciprocating motion in the boundary-layer lubrication regime.
